Output 57867beb788686a17565215f8317c74ad5246818cfea9e741e4805a86cb40e82:0

value
75000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22a537d57d2de6a2c4cd231e58e30d4abf6bb1b9 OP_EQUALVERIFY OP_CHECKSIG
address
14ABu5UaphAWchhLRWhQsxT4aLdy8QdRAD
transaction
57867beb788686a17565215f8317c74ad5246818cfea9e741e4805a86cb40e82
spent
true